On June 3rd, Dr. Hanna Bisiw-Kotei visited mining sites in Nkomteng. She is the Administrator of the Mineral Development Fund (MDF). The visit aimed to assess the environmental impact of mining activities.
Dr. Kotei was joined by the local Assemblyman, a site foreman, and security personnel. During the visit, authorities arrested two Indian nationals and ten others for illegal mining. Many miners fled upon seeing the team.
After the operation, Dr. Kotei expressed concern about environmental degradation from illegal mining. She promised that MDF would work with MPs and MMDCEs to hold offenders accountable. They aim to strengthen enforcement efforts against illegal activities.
Dr. Kotei emphasized the need for public education on illegal mining's dangers. She mentioned severe health risks like kidney and liver failure from toxic exposure. Tragically, two lives have already been lost in mining incidents.
This visit is part of MDF's ongoing efforts to monitor mining activities. The goal is to ensure sustainable and responsible resource exploitation across the country.
